5. At the garage door opener motor (in the garage), locate
the "LEARN" or "TRAINING" button. This can usually
be found where the hanging antenna wire is attached to
the garage door opener/device motor. Firmly press and
release the "LEARN" or "TRAINING" button. On some
garage door openers/devices there may be a light that
blinks when the garage door opener/device is in the
LEARN/TRAIN mode.
NOTE: You have 30 seconds in which to initiate the next
step after the LEARN button has been pressed.
6. Return to the vehicle and press the programmed
HomeLink button twice (holding the button for two
seconds each time). The EVIC will display "CHANNEL #
TRANSMIT". If the garage door opener/device activates,
programming is complete.
NOTE: If the garage door opener/device does not acti-
vate, press the button a third time (for two seconds) to
complete the training.

Reprogramming A Single HomeLink Button
To reprogram a channel that has been previously trained,
follow these steps:
1. Turn the ignition switch to the ON/RUN position.
2. Press and hold the desired HomeLink button until
the EVIC displays "CHANNEL # TRAINING" Do not
release the button.
3. Without releasing the button proceed with "Program-
ming A Rolling Code" Step 2 and follow all remaining
steps.
